Major reorganizing of DotNetEngine. Moved common script engine parts to ScriptEngine.Common, only .Net-specific code in DotNetEngine. AppDomains, event handling, event execution queue and multithreading, script load/unload queue, etc has been moved to ScriptEngine.Common.
Loads of things has been put into interfaces instead of the specific class. We are now one step closer to ScriptServer, and its very easy to implement new script languages. Just a few lines required to make them a OpenSim script module with all its glory.

42 /// <summary>
43 /// Loads scripts
44 /// Compiles them if necessary
45 /// Execute functions for EventQueueManager (Sends them to script on other AppDomain for execution)
46 /// </summary>
47 ///
48
49 // This class is as close as you get to the script without being inside script class. It handles all the dirty work for other classes.
50 // * Keeps track of running scripts
51 // * Compiles script if necessary (through "Compiler")
52 // * Loads script (through "AppDomainManager" called from for example "EventQueueManager")
53 // * Executes functions inside script (called from for example "EventQueueManager" class)
54 // * Unloads script (through "AppDomainManager" called from for example "EventQueueManager")
55 // * Dedicated load/unload thread, and queues loading/unloading.
56 // This so that scripts starting or stopping will not slow down other theads or whole system.
57 //
